Deploy Guide — Step 6: Load testing the Cartwheel checkout flow

Before routing traffic, run the Stresser suite against the staging checkout endpoint at 500 virtual users for 15 minutes. The load generator authenticates against the payments sandbox, so its env file must be complete or every transaction fails at the tokenization step and skews the numbers. Verify the env file contains the sandbox credential line, which is:

sealed setting: VAULT_KEY20=69e2a0b23f1a79fbf692

Ticket: Intermittent connection failures — Farelight pricing experiment

Since Tuesday, the Farelight ticket-pricing experiment service has seen sporadic connection timeouts during peak traffic, roughly 2% of requests. Pool exhaustion is the leading theory: the experiment shard allows 40 connections but the variant-assignment job holds several open during batch writes. Mitigation so far: raised pool ceiling to 60 and added a 5-second acquire timeout. For the eng sync, note the affected shard is reached via the connection string below.

replica DSN, tawef-hahap: mysql://eliix_svc:FiIC0jz@db-394a.lumiclabs.internal:5432/holius

Finance Review — FY Headcount Plan

The draft plan for Orvale Analytics adds eleven roles, weighted toward engineering and two senior positions in revenue operations. Salary assumptions use the Bramford market survey, with a 4% contingency. Attrition modeling remains conservative at 9%. Before circulating to department leads, please read the note appended below carefully.

board note of yafop-yahof: Only 63 of the 459 pilot accounts renewed Keliel, so a churn review is set for January 7. Kaswynox Logistics is in early talks to buy Praaxek Works for about $297.2 million.

Ticket BRK-2217: Vault locked mid-upgrade (Pelmore Broker 4.x → 5.x)

Upgrade of the Pelmore message broker stalled at schema migration. The credentials vault auto-locked after three failed unseal attempts by the migration job. Broker queues are drained; consumers paused. Do NOT rerun the migrator until the vault is open, or offsets will desync. Manual unseal is required. Future maintainers: the approved unseal phrase is recorded immediately below.

unlock words, yagaf-hahog: casvan-fraath-praath-novwyn-prair-eliath